    Steria wins £75 million outsourcing extension from BT

BT has extended a long-running financial application outsourcing deal with Steria for another six years.

By Nicole Kobie, 4 Sep 2008 at 11:57

BT has spent £75.5 million to extend its outsourcing agreement with services provider Steria for another six years.

The two companies have worked together for nearly two decades. The extension of the contract will see Steria continue its role offering applications support for finance and accounting for the telcoms giant.

Kevin Richards, director of enterprise management platform in BT Design, said: "Steria has worked with BT for many years and has evolved its services and approaches along with BT’s changing business and IT requirements. Keeping the business process and IT service closely coupled provides us with a streamlined and efficient service that maintains effectiveness at critical business periods."
